Source: "north Carolina Centinel And Fayetteville Gazette" Saturday, August 15, 1795
Written: July 16, 1795

Agreeable to an Order of the county court of Cumberland.
On the 20th day of August next, will be exposed to public sale, at the
plantation of William Kirkpatrick, deceased, at the mouth of Rockfish creek -
all the perishable property of said dec.
Consisting of Horses and Cattle, among which are three yoke of oxen. Also
household furniture, a Waggon and Cart, a four oared Boat, a riding Chair, and
an excellent Seine, with a variety of other articles. Six months credit will be
allowed the purchasers.
At the same time & place will be rented, a valuable Saw-Mill on rockfish, with
the timber belonging to the same, which is extremely plentiful, and convenient.
The mill is now in good order for sawing, and there is navigation for rafts,
from the same into Cape-fear river, which is not more than a mile from the said
Saw mill.
Likewise, to be hired at the same time and place, a number of valuable and
likely Negroes, some of them well acquainted with plantation business, and
others excellent sawyers.
Joseph Thames, Adm'r
Elizabeth Kirkpatrick, Adm'x
July 16, 1795
